How to Choose the Right Running or Rucking Vest

For summer trail work, ventilation, fit, and storage are the priorities. Ventilation: choose vests with large mesh panels or spacer-mesh liners that wick sweat and allow airflow across the torso. Mesh-first designs reduce heat build-up; dense fabrics like 600D Oxford increase durability but can trap heat unless paired with open vents. Fit and stability: a vest must hug your torso without restricting breathing. Look for adjustable straps and an ergonomic cut—X-shaped or cross-strap designs are common for women’s fits. Adjustable sizing systems help reduce chafe and movement on technical trails. Weight distribution: removable sandbags let you add small increments and keep load balanced across the chest and back; even distribution prevents lower-back strain and reduces bounce while running. Storage and pockets: summer runs require minimal bulk but smart access to essentials. Seek multiple small pockets for gels, phone, and keys; a dedicated hydration sleeve or compatibility with soft flasks is a big plus. For longer rucks, larger pockets that secure with zips or elastic loops are useful. Materials and durability: nylon and 600D Oxford are common for durability; rubberized or ABS components can add structure. Mesh and spacer fabrics improve breathability. Consider how the vest tolerates sweat and whether components (like sandbags) are corrosion-resistant. Smell and cleaning: some vests emit a chemical odor out of the package—washable vests that allow removal of weights are easier to clean and will freshen faster. If you’ll be using the vest daily in heat, prioritize washable liners and quick-dry mesh. Sizing and gender-specific cuts: women’s designs often feature an X-shaped or tapered waist to reduce shifting; unisex and men's models may require tighter adjustment. Always compare your chest and torso measurements to a vendor sizing chart and allow for one layer underneath. Pocket layout vs. weight: avoid vests with oversized stash pockets that place items low on the back and bounce; pockets on the chest or very secure zippered rear pockets are preferable for running. Summary tip: for hot-weather trail runs pick a mesh-forward, low-bounce vest with enough pockets for flasks and gels. If you plan serious weighted rucking, prioritize durable fabric and shoulder padding.

Frequently Asked Questions

How should a running vest fit for hot-weather trail runs?

It should sit snugly against your torso without restricting your breath. Aim for minimal bounce: tighten adjustment straps so the vest doesn’t move while running. Prioritize mesh panels or spacer-mesh liners to allow airflow across the chest and back.

Can I wash these weighted vests?

Most adjustable vests with removable sandbags are washable—always remove weights before washing. Use a gentle cycle or hand wash the liner and air-dry to preserve materials and minimize chemical odors.

How much extra weight is appropriate for summer runs?

Start light—add 5–10% of your body weight or begin with small increments (1–2 lbs) and increase slowly. For most runners, 6–12 lbs is a reasonable range to add stability and strength benefits without compromising form or overheating.
